Chapter 3

Configuration

This Chapter provides details of the configuration process.

Overview

This chapter describes the procedure for:

Quick setup

Wireless access point configuration

Using the Status screens

PCs on your local LAN may also require configuration. For details, see Chapter 4 - PC Con-
figuration
.

Other configuration may also be required, depending on which features and functions of the
Wireless Gateway you wish to use. Use the table below to locate detailed instructions for the
required functions.
